Find LCM of 444,869,179,121,948 with Prime Factorization


2 444, 869, 179, 121, 948
2 222, 869, 179, 121, 474
3 111, 869, 179, 121, 237
11 37, 869, 179, 121, 79
79 37, 79, 179, 11, 79
37, 1, 179, 11, 1

Multiply the prime numbers at the bottom and the left side.

2 x 2 x 3 x 11 x 79 x 37 x 1 x 179 x 11 x 1 = 759711084

Therefore, the lowest common multiple of 444,869,179,121,948 is 759711084.
